Brigitta Farkas

MISCP, CORU registered physiotherapist.

Founder /director of Beaumont Physiotherapy.

Brigitta is a CORU registered Chartered Physiotherapist with a special interest in musculosceletal-,sport and neuro-physiotherapy.

Brigitta qualified with a BSc honours degree in Physiotherapy from University of Szeged, Hungary in 2007.

Brigitta graduated as a General Nurse in 2002 from Semmelweis College, Gyula, Hungary. She worked as a nurse in part and full time at the University Hospital of Szeged until finished her degree in physiotherapy in 2007. Then she moved to Ireland and worked in private practice settings until 2012.

She founded Beaumont Physiotherapy in 2012 to share her passion for physiotherapy. Her vision was create a physiotherapy practice to provide high quality service, with hands on treatment, tailored to the patient’s needs.

Brigitta regularly participate in postgraduate continous professional training and keeps up to date with the latest literatures to provide evidence based service.

She has extensive post-graduate training in many areas, such as manual therapy, scoliosis treatment based on Schroth-method, chronic pain, McKenzie-method, sports taping, dry needling.

Manual Lymphatic Drainage
The technique was pioneered by Doctor Emil Vodder in the 1930s for the treatment of chronic sinusitis and other immune disorders. Manual Lymphatic Drainage helps promote the movement of lymphatic fluid to healthy vessels out of the swollen limb,transporting it back to the normal circulatory system. McKenzie method
All therapists at Beaumont Physiotherapy are qualified and experienced in using the McKenzie Method. The McKenzie Method was developed in the 1960’s by Robin McKenzie, a physical therapist in New Zealand.
